Description

290-34G is a launch pin/tab and dielectric manufactured by Southwest Microwave. This pin/tab and dielectric has a 0.036" Pin Diameter, 0.237" Pin Length, 0.050" Tab Length, 0.117" Dielectric Diameter, and 0.187" Dielectric Length. All Southwest Microwave Launch Pin/Tab and Dielectric Transition to Stripline are made of Beryllium Copper, with Gold over Nickel plating, and Virgin TFE Fluorocarbon. Southwest Microwave Cage Code: 66049
Measurements
Pin Diameter (d. Dia.): 0.036"
Pin Length (L1): 0.237"
Tab Length (T): 0.050"
Dielectric Diameter (D. Dia.): 0.117"
Dielectric Length (L2): 0.187"
Mechanical Specifications
| Item | Specification | 
|---|---|
|  Launch Pin | Beryllium Copper (BeCu) Per ASTM B196/197 | 
|  Plating | Gold over Nickel Per MIL-G-45204 | 
| Dielectric | Virgin TFE Fluorocarbon Per ASTM D1710 and ASTM D1457 |
